Cofense is a post-perimeter phishing defense vendor founded in 2011, headquartered in Ashburn, Virginia. The platform combines AI-driven threat detection with expert validation to identify phishing attacks that escape standard email gateways, then automates quarantine and remediation. The company operates a global threat intelligence feed, analyzing known and novel attacks across customer organizations. Sales and implementation teams drive customer acquisition and onboarding across North America and EMEA, while data and engineering teams maintain streaming pipelines, detection models, and integration layers for customer SaaS environments.
Cofense runs on AWS and Azure infrastructure with Kafka and Kinesis for event streaming, Apache Spark for data processing, and dual warehouse architecture (AWS Redshift and Azure Synapse). Data feeds into Power BI and Tableau for analytics. Salesforce and Outreach power sales operations.
Active projects include data pipeline development on Azure/AWS, customer phishing simulation programs, product onboarding and implementation, DACH regional expansion, and BI tool integrations to surface detection and remediation metrics to security teams.
